QuickCashBuddy
"Turning trust between friends into credit histories."
QuickCashBuddy formalises informal lending to bring credit-invisible earners into the formal credit system. A credit-active buddy vouches for a friend — passes a credit check, signs surety and a debit mandate — and the friend borrows in their own name after an affordability check on verified real income. Every repayment is reported to the credit bureaus, so a rising credit score is the product, not a side effect.
The buddy earns a share of the profit for staking their good name and covers the loan on default, with liability capped, written, and shown in rands upfront. Friends who build a score can become the next buddies — access compounds through communities. Built on legal rails: NCA affordability rules, NCR interest and fee caps, and POPIA-compliant direct consent. Honestly pre-launch: no loans issued yet; working toward NCR registration and a first pilot cohort from the live waitlist.
